Do not waste your time or money!
By ,
Please note that the word "Resort" is used very loosely here. In actuality, this is a 40+ year old Motor Inn in dire need of repairs. Yes, it's located right at the Speedway, but the Speedway is in a pretty bad neighborhood surrounded by Pawn Shops and Liquor Stores. On top of that, when we tried to check in an hour early (just to register our names and go on with our day) we were chewed out by the crabby old lady behind the desk. We drove 15 minutes towards town, booked a very nice room at the Country Inn & Suites, and cancelled the room at the "resort". For less than $20.00 more we had a super clean room, indoor pool, free breakfast... you get the idea.
